Super Soap Weekend?

Just discovered that Super Soap Weekend coincides with when I'm planning my trip. For someone else, fine, but for me.... eeuw. So...how popular an event is this? Anyone know what it does to MGM Studios, and how it affects the other parks? Does this mean the following week may be more crowded? It's certainly not too late for me to reschedule.... <g>

Re: Super Soap Weekend?

I guess being the resident soap freak and SSW attendee here I should answer this. Super Soap Weekend is one of the most attended events at Disney. Especially considering it's just 1 weekend. Not spread out like Star Wars weekends are.

MGM turns into a soap frenzy. Especially this year with it being Super Soap Weekend's 10th Anniversary. It's expected to be bigger and better than ever. Expect hotels to be filled and MGM to be packed wall to wall with people. The following week is not as bad as most people leave by Tuesday. Most people don't show up until Thursday night or Friday. Other parks are not bad at all. At MGM you'll encounter them building the stage infront of the Hat for the week before and also them putting up the signs and stuff. During that weekend some things are closed. There is no fast passes because they use those for the autographs. Lines are short or non existant for most rides, but the crowds are hard for some people to deal with. You often hear people complaining because they didn't realize that it was like that or didn't know that weekend was occuring. I guess that's everything. It's crazy but if you can avoid MGM you'll be fine. If you have any other questions post or PM me!

Re: Super Soap Weekend?

Here is a summary of the weekend. It's long.

You get to the park by bus around 7 am and by car anywhere after 6 am. You line up outside. They let you go in at 8 am and you following the signs to the places to get the fast passes for the show you want. You wait in that line and can get 1 per ticket. Then go back to the back or to a different line. GH and AMC go the fastest. You can usually get 2 tickets per person. They are usually all gone by about 10 am. After that the fun starts! Autograph sessions go on throughout the day and the stars are so nice and accomodating. You can take pictures, they'll sign whatever you want. Talk to you. It's awesome. They have motorcades and star conversations. They usually do this by show. So they'll have 5 people from AMC go on cars down the main rd to the stage and then they take questions from the crowd and stuff. Last year it was hosted by Alexa Havins (Babe, AMC) and most likely will be again. Those were held on Sunday. Saturday the stage is used for live tapings of Soap talk with Ty treadway and Lisa Rinna). It's like the motorcade only taped for TV. They have different things around the park. Who Wants to Be A Millionaire. they have 2 soap stars and if you get the top score you get to play the game with them. It's a lot of fun and they pick pairs that are a lot of fun. There are also things where you can have a chance to maybe act out a scene with some of the guys from the show. Wish they'd do this with some of the women! lol. It's just a blast. ABC and Disney go ALL OUT for this weekend and that's why it's so popular. There are other things I cant really explain but they are just as fun. Each night they have an "All Star Jam Concert" where the stars that sing perform. Befire this is the Main Motorcade with all the stars. Easily one of the highlights.
